Sorry about the spelling...but i have a question. My hubby is sick and needs a humidifier in our room which is where tango is. Will the humidity hurt him? Its a little humidifier and hes in a custom 2x4 cage that we built so there isnt like big opening that lets in air from our room like a screen top would. So is it alright if we use the humidifier?
I really couldn't tell you if it will be okay or not. But the acceptable amount of humidity for a beardie is like 30ish% to 50% no higher or you risk Tango getting a RI.
Keep a close eye on the humidity level in Tango's viv if it get's higher than I've mentioned......
I would either put hubby up in another room which would be the best choice for not stressing Tango, or moving Tango's viv which will stress him, or you could possibly put Tango to sleep after snuggles in a temporary critter carrier or something like that at night in another room while the humidifier is on.
